Single-layer Feed Forward Network: It is the simplest and most basic architecture of ANN’s. It consists of only two layers- the input layer and the output layer. The input layer consists of ‘m’ input neurons connected to each of the ‘n’ output neurons. The connections carry weights w 11 and so on. ryan the world tv
